技术问答类推广文案:GBase 数据库分布式部署有哪些?
在当今数据量爆炸式增长的背景下,企业对数据库系统的要求也越来越高。传统的单机数据库已难以满足大规模数据存储、高并发访问和高可用性的需求。因此,分布式数据库成为越来越多企业的选择。作为国内领先的数据库产品之一,GBase 提供了多种分布式数据库部署方案,以适应不同业务场景的需求。
一、什么是 GBase 分布式数据库?
GBase 是由南大通用研发的一系列关系型数据库产品,支持多种部署模式,包括单机版、集群版和分布式架构。其中,分布式数据库是指通过将数据分布在多个节点上,实现数据的横向扩展、负载均衡和高可用性。
GBase 的分布式数据库设计旨在解决传统数据库在性能、扩展性和容灾能力方面的瓶颈,适用于金融、政务、电信等对数据安全与稳定性要求较高的行业。
二、GBase 分布式数据库的主要部署方式
GBase 提供了多种分布式数据库部署方案,以下是几种常见的部署方式:
1. 主从复制架构(Master-Slave)
- 特点:一个主节点负责写操作,多个从节点进行读操作,实现读写分离。
- 适用场景:读多写少的业务场景,如报表系统、数据分析平台。
- 优势:提升查询性能,降低主节点压力,具备一定的高可用性。
2. 分片(Sharding)架构
- 特点:将数据按照一定规则(如按用户ID、时间等)拆分到不同的节点上。
- 适用场景:数据量大、访问频繁的业务场景,如电商平台、社交平台。
- 优势:提升系统整体吞吐量,支持水平扩展,适合大规模数据处理。
3. 集群部署(Cluster)
- 特点:多个节点组成集群,共同承担数据存储和计算任务,具备自动故障转移能力。
- 适用场景:对高可用性要求高的业务,如金融交易系统、实时风控系统。
- 优势:提升系统可靠性,减少单点故障风险,支持动态扩容。
4. 云原生分布式部署
- 特点:基于容器化技术(如 Docker、Kubernetes)进行部署,支持弹性伸缩和自动化运维。
- 适用场景:混合云或公有云环境下的应用,如微服务架构、DevOps 环境。
- 优势:灵活部署、快速响应业务变化,降低运维复杂度。
三、GBase 分布式数据库的优势
- 高可用性:支持多副本机制和自动故障切换,确保业务连续性。
- 高性能:通过数据分片、负载均衡等技术提升系统吞吐能力。
- 易扩展性:支持横向扩展,可根据业务增长灵活增加节点。
- 兼容性强:兼容标准 SQL 和主流开发框架,便于迁移和集成。
- 安全性高:提供完善的权限控制、数据加密和审计功能。
四、如何选择适合的 GBase 分布式部署方案?
选择合适的部署方式需结合以下因素:
- 业务类型:读多写少还是写多读少?
- 数据规模:是否需要水平扩展?
- 可用性要求:是否需要 7×24 小时不间断运行?
- 运维能力:是否有专业的 DBA 团队支持?
建议根据实际业务需求,结合 GBase 官方文档和案例分析,选择最适合的部署方案。
五、结语
随着数据规模的不断增长和业务复杂度的提升,分布式数据库已成为企业构建现代化数据平台的必然选择。GBase 作为一款成熟、稳定、高性能的国产数据库产品,提供了丰富的分布式部署方案,能够满足不同行业、不同场景下的多样化需求。
如您正在寻找一个可扩展、高可用、易管理的数据库解决方案,不妨考虑 GBase 分布式数据库。无论是传统企业还是新兴科技公司,GBase 都能为您提供强有力的数据支撑。
了解更多 GBase 分布式数据库信息,请访问官网或联系我们的技术团队。